Man Charged After Fort Campbell Boulevard Traffic Stop

A traffic stop for disregarding a traffic light led to drug charges for a Hopkinsville man on Tuesday morning.

Christian County Sheriff’s deputies say they stopped a vehicle driven by 55-year-old William Pauley after he went through a red light on Fort Campbell Boulevard, and during the stop, he kept giving the deputy his debit card when asked for his license.

He reportedly showed signs of being under the influence of some kind of substance, and after a law enforcement K9 alerted on the vehicle, a bag containing suspected meth was found…
